Delta College of Arts & Technology Career Programs

Delta College of Arts & Technology (referred to as Delta College of Arts & Technology) is a Private, 2-4 years school located in Baton Rouge, LA. Its highest level of offering is Associate's degree. The 2023 tuition & fees at Delta College of Arts & Technology is $29,800. The school has a total enrollment of 304 and the students to faculty ratio is 6.67% (15 to 1).

Who Accredits Delta College of Arts & Technology

Delta College of Arts & Technology is accredited by Council on Occupational Education (6/12/2015 - Current).
